Interaction and Accessibility



Making sure effective communication and easy availability between you and your criminal defense attorney is critical for the success of your situation. When handling lawful issues, clear and open communication can make a considerable difference in the end result. Right here are some bottom lines to think about regarding interaction and schedule when hiring a criminal defense lawyer:

1. ** Response Time **: Make sure to inquire about the attorney's ordinary reaction time to e-mails, calls, or messages. Quick feedbacks can suggest their devotion to your case.

2. ** Preferred Technique of Interaction **: Comprehend how your lawyer likes to interact. Some lawyers might prefer emails for paperwork, while others might favor call for immediate matters.

3. ** Availability for Meetings **: Ask about the attorney's availability for in-person meetings. Face-to-face communications can be beneficial for reviewing delicate details.


4. ** Backup Interaction Plan **: Ask about what occurs if your attorney is not available because of emergency situations or other factors. Knowing there's a back-up plan guarantees continuity in your situation.

Charge Framework and Layaway Plan



To proceed with working with a criminal defense attorney, comprehending their cost structure and readily available layaway plan is essential.

When researching possible lawyers, inquire about how they charge for their services. Some attorneys may have a flat fee for the entire case, while others bill hourly. It's important to know if there are any kind of added costs, such as court costs or specialist witnesses, that you may be responsible for.

Talking about payment plans upfront can help you prevent financial surprises down the line. Ask if the lawyer uses flexible settlement choices or if they call for a lump sum upfront. Recognizing the monetary aspect of working with a criminal defense lawyer can help you plan and spending plan appropriately.

Make sure to obtain all fee contracts in contacting avoid any type of misunderstandings in the future. By being clear regarding the charge structure and layaway plan from the start, you can make sure a transparent and effective working relationship with your lawyer.
